Private psychiatry refers to mental healthcare services provided by professionals who operate outside the National Health Service (NHS). Clients who select private psychiatry frequently look for quicker access to appointments, a broader option of specialists, and numerous treatment choices that may not be readily available through public services.

Factor | Description |
---|---|
Specialization | Focus areas such as stress and anxiety, anxiety, or trauma healing. |
Experience | Years in practice and experience with your particular condition. |
Payment Options | Service expenses, payment methods, and insurance coverage. |
Consultation Approach | Design of communication and comfort level during consultations. |
Accessibility | Flexibility of visit scheduling and place of practice. |
If you are experiencing persistent symptoms affecting your life, such as severe state of mind swings, stress and anxiety, depression, or modifications in behavior, it may be time to consider consulting a psychiatrist.
Yes, people can self-refer to private psychiatrists without requiring a recommendation from a GP, which is often needed for NHS services.
Numerous private health insurance plans offer protection for professional psychiatric services, however it’s important to check your particular policy details.
During the very first consultation, you can expect to discuss your symptoms, personal history, treatment objectives, and any concerns you might have relating to the treatment process.
The duration of treatment varies extensively depending on the individual’s needs and the intricacy of their condition. Regular continuous assessments will assist figure out the ongoing requirement of sessions.
